Output 50a5a4c9ab24c31c2861c4f194b28636b3344b1d9163bc5bdc7c1b5eaf7ec3c9:3

value
2053864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dfbbfc8f4097f02060d6240ca9c116c6a81f890 OP_EQUAL
address
35t9v1nkLjtDfpBzmcnDvF1y4adGsUpaUE
transaction
50a5a4c9ab24c31c2861c4f194b28636b3344b1d9163bc5bdc7c1b5eaf7ec3c9
spent
true